MT2122 Single-Chip Broadband Tuner
The MicroTuner™ MT2122 is a
fully integrated single-chip tuner,
with functional blocks specifically
designed to ease implementation of
high-performance analog and digital
OpenCable™ set-top boxes. It
supports advanced analog/digital
set-top boxes (STB) including
OpenCable™, home gateways,
cable modems and HDTV
applications.
The MT2122 has been
developed to give manufacturers
design flexibility at low cost without
compromising high performance.
The MT2122 receives signal
from 48 – 1100 MHz. It features
integrated filter components and
controls that allow for a simple,
alignment-free pre-select filter. This
provides excellent end-to-end
linearity performance in severely
sloped input conditions. MT2122
greatly reduces complexity for the
Multimedia over Coax Alliance
(MoCA™) applications.
Its dual-conversion architecture
ensures consistent OpenCable -
compliant performance with no
manual alignment. The on-chip
buffer amplifier for Forward Data
Channel (FDC) reduces bill of
materials (BOM) cost while
improving performance compared to
solutions using a directional coupler.
The MT2122 includes a PIN
diode attenuator linearizer circuit that
can drive a PI-network pin diode
attenuator in the signal path. The
MT2122 also supports multi-tuner
front-end implementations and is
programmable through a serial bus
interface.
APPLICATIONS
• Advanced analog and digital
set-top boxes (STB) including
OpenCable.
• Home gateways
• Cable modems
• HDTV
FEATURES
• Output fully compatible with
demodulators for MoCA,
NTSC, PAL, SECAM, DAVIC,
DVB-C, DOCSIS®, Euro-
DOCSIS™, OpenCable and
other standards
• On-chip amplifier for Forward
Data Channel (FDC)
• Ease of multi-tuner front-end
implementations
• Dual-conversion architecture
for consistent OpenCable
compliant performance
• Serial control interface
• One general purpose output
controllable via serial control
interface
• On-chip frequency synthesis
system integrating PLL, VCOs
and varactors.
• 1.1 GHz bandwidth
• No need for the 28 V to 33 V
supplies typically required by
traditional cable tuners
• Automatic frequency control
(AFC) voltage detector for
frequency fine-tuning
• Integrated temperature
sensor for thermally sensitive
systems
• 3.3 V and 5 V serial bus
compatible
• No tunable parts required
• Simple interface to external
filters
• Software shutdown mode
• Small 8 mm x 8 mm 56-pin
QFN package
